Part 2
Rupert makes it to Mexico on the second day, spends three days hunting down the address, and then one waiting for the occupant of the small house, a man Rupert doesn't know, to appear.
Xander left weeks ago. The next flight for Paris doesn't leave until the morning.
It's been a week since Rupert left England by the time he checks into a Parisian hotel. Finding a trace of Xander here is going to take more patience, Rupert thinks; the man he talked to hadn't known where or why Xander was leaving for France.
There's a message waiting on his voice mail when he comes back from breakfast two mornings later. Xander's card was used to buy a train ticket about three weeks ago, Andrew's voice says, to Calais. Maybe he's coming back?
Rupert shakes his head and shuts the phone. Whatever Xander's doing, he's not going back to England.
